Federal officials flagged 252 properties on Fort Myers Beach where trailers and structures must go. The situation became more confusing after FEMA first allowed temporary trailers but later said they didn’t meet requirements, leading to mixed messages about deadlines.
“The easiest thing to move is a trailer, I don’t understand it, I don’t think anybody understands it, and we need someone to fight, and I’d like to know where our governor is,” said Fred Mallone, co-owner of Buffalo Grill, according to Fox 4 News.
Work trucks, licensed trailers, and food stands made the list. Even Mayor Dan Allers found his trailer marked for removal…
